Cubic yards
The cubic yard is a unit of volume equal to exactly 764.555 litres (27 cubic feet), used primarily in the United States for large quantities of bulk materials such as concrete, gravel, sand, topsoil, and asphalt. Construction projects in the US routinely specify material quantities in cubic yards. One cubic yard of concrete weighs approximately 2,000–2,400 kg depending on the mix.
US barrels
The US liquid barrel is a unit of volume equal to exactly 31.5 US gallons (approximately 119.24 litres), distinct from the oil barrel (42 gallons) and used for beer, wine, and other liquid products in US commerce. The US beer barrel, used to measure draught beer, is 31 gallons in practice, though the legal definition varies by state. This unit is important in the brewing and beverage industry for bulk production and distribution calculations.
